The Parts Department is at the heart of our operations. Our Parts Advisors are responsible for the stock control of a wide range of vehicle parts and accessories. This includes the ordering, selling, and managing of stock to ensure that we meet the needs of our trade counter customers and to guarantee that our workshop team have the parts and accessories that they need to complete their daily tasks.
Your duties will vary from day to day and could include:
- Providing advice to customers who are having problems with their vehicles.
- Taking sales orders from customers both face to face and over the phone.
- Stock control for vehicle parts and accessories.
- Maintaining an ordered stock room.
- Raising invoices for parts sold.
- Liaison with internal teams to ensure the correct stock is in place at the right time.
